From Children's Software Revue® -- "Subscribe Now!"

In this animated electronic book, Tigger's friends have had enough of Tigger's bouncing. Having been knocked down one time too many, Rabbit comes up with a plan where Pooh, Tigger and friends go deep into the woods to try to lose Tigger. The scheme backfires and Rabbit himself gets lost, learning an important lesson about true friendship. For kids unfamiliar with the story, it seemed that one or two pages were missing. Children were confused about what happened between the time that Rabbit was wandering about with his friends and when suddenly he was on his own. Although the activities are pretty much the usual stuff, they are very well integrated into the story line. For instance, after Tigger knocks over Rabbit in his vegetable garden, kids help pick up scattered vegetables and rinse out clothes splashed with dirt. When Tigger gets stuck up in a tree, they direct Pooh through a maze so he can provide some help. There's also a vegetable matching game, a tic-tac-toe game and a memory game in which kids match sequences of bouncing characters. Children cannot save their games but they can choose from three levels of difficulty. They can also easily jump to pages of interest. Testers' biggest complaint was that the characters sometimes talk too much. None of the kids discovered on their own that the space bar interrupts the narration and animation. On the whole children loved the appealing Winnie the Pooh and his friends, as well as the brief but engaging story. The voice-overs sound just like the "real" characters, and the graphics are excellent.
Teaches: early reading, logic, memory
Age Range: 3, 4, 5, 6 Copyright © 2000 Children's Software Revue

Read, Learn, and Play with Pooh...and Tigger Too!

Product Information

Hoo, hoo, hoo,hoo! Learning is what Tiggers like best! And now you can build all kinds of reading and problem-solving skills as you play alongside Tigger, Pooh and all their friends. Read along or listen to this classic story as Tigger discovers his friends havetired of his bouncing ways. You're sure to feel a rumbly in your brain as you play the fun skill-building games - and learn the true meaning of friendship.


  • Build vocabulary and word recognition
  • Improve memoryand problem solving skills
  • Increase listening comprehension
  • Grow with multiple skill levels
  • Enjoy hours of skill building gameplay


Fun Activities Include

Friends in theWood:  Discover fun surprises and what-not as you explore the Haunted Acre Wood.

Skate with Rabbit: It's the cutting edge of learning as phrases are pronounced and highlighted to build word recognition.

Rabbit'sGarden:  It takes concentration and a green thumb to match the pairs of vegetables.

Tic-Tac-Roo: Challenge Roo to a game of Tic-Tac-Toe.  Multiple skill levels make it fun for all ages.

Everyone Bounce!: Bounce along with Tigger, Pooh, and their friends in this fast-paced memory game.

Icy Maze: Guide Pooh through a series of challenging mazes to rescue Tigger.
